Title: Charter Amendment - Municipal Elections FOR the purpose of providing for the election of the Mayor, the Comptroller, and the President and Members of the City Council in 2016 and in every succeeding fourth year; adjusting the terms of office for those elected in 2011; and submitting this amendment to the qualified voters of the City for adoption or rejection.

SECTION 1. BE IT RESOLVED BY THE MAYOR AND CITY COUNCIL OF BALTIMORE, That the City Charter is proposed to be amended to read as follows:

Baltimore City Charter


Article III – City Council

§ 2. Members.

(a) Election and term.

(1) The voters shall elect the members of the City Council on the Tuesday next after the first Monday in November [2007] 2016, and on the same day and month in every succeeding fourth year.
